Neilson left the club by mutual consent with them languishing in the League One relegation zone in January 2018, following a poor run of one victory in 11 matches. Neilson, who played as a right-back, started his senior career with Hearts, making 200 Scottish Premier League (SPL) appearances and winning the Scottish Cup in 2006 with the club.
